Growing Italian cypress in pots is easy to do. Italian cypress tress are drought-tolerant evergreen conifers that love lots of sunlight and warm temperatures. Here's everything to know about how to grow Italian cypress in containers.

Tall and stately, slender Italian cypress trees stand like columns in formal gardens or front of estates. They grow fast and are relatively care free when planted appropriately. For more Italian cypress information including tips on how to grow an Italian cypress, click here.

Turn your backyard into a private oasis with our top privacy trees: 🌲 Thuja Green Giant: Fast growing trees that are great for filling large spaces 🌲 Italian Cypress: Best for compact spaces in dry climates 🌲 Leyland Cypress: Best for filling large spaces in warmer climates 🌲 Taylor Juniper: Best for narrow spaces 🌲 Emerald Green: Best for narrow spaces and clay soil Click to find the perfect trees for your backyard.
